BURNING MAN TICKETS 2002
Reno

All Price Levels Go On Sale: Monday, January 21, 2002
We Will Not Accept A Post Mark Before That Date

Please purchase tickets at the highest price level you can afford. Purchasing higher-priced tickets leaves lower priced tickets available for those who need them most. The ticket allotments are divided by amounts and dates. You MUST pay attention to post mark deadlines. Please Read ALL instructions carefully before you run towards the mailbox. There is important NEW information for 2002 ticket sales. You may also find answers to frequently asked questions.

Ticket Structure:
From: January 21 - June 30, 2002

  • U.S. Mail order, internet sales, walkup / outlet
  • Mail order: Money Order or Cashier's Check only
  • Unlimited number per person or per order

4,000 tickets at $165 -- THE $165 TICKETS ARE SOLD OUT!
4,000 tickets at $175 -- SOLD OUT - There are a limited number available via Outlet ONLY!
4,000 tickets at $185 -- deadline June 30, 2002

UNLIMITED TICKETS at $200 -- deadline Fri., Aug. 23, 2002

DEADLINES:

  • After June 30, 2002, all pre-sale tickets are $200 (through 8/23/02).
  • Last postmark we will accept for mail orders is July 15, 2002.
  • All $200 tickets sold online after August 1 are WILL CALL at the event Gate. Online purchases end Friday, August 23, 2002 at midnight PST.
  • Tickets purchased at the gate will cost at least $250 and will increase each day of the event. NO tickets will be sold at the event after 11 PM on Thursday, August 29, 2002.
  • All orders must be postmarked by 11:59 PM of the appropriate deadline date. Incorrect, illegible, or late orders will not be accepted and will be returned to you.

What Everyone Needs To Know About Burning Man
(but were afraid to ask)

  • Your Address is Never Sold to vendors, corporations or any outside business. All addresses stay within our database. Tickets are our primary source of revenue.
  • We are not responsible for tickets lost in the mail.
  • Tickets are non-refundable, even if you do not attend the event.
  • If you cannot attend, you may sell your ticket on the e-playa on this website.
  • You must bring your ticket with you to enter Black Rock City.
  • If you forget your ticket, you will have to buy a new one at gate prices.
  • Children under 12 accompanied by a parent will be admitted for free.
  • People under 18 must be accompanied by an adult over 21 years of age.
  • Dogs are highly discouraged at the event. Please see The Pet Unfriendly Playa section of our website...If you must bring your dog, Pooch Passes are $100, and should be purchased prior to the event through the SF office.
  • Burning Man is a temporary art community, created in the Black Rock Desert of Nevada. It is an experiment in radical self-expression, now in its 17th year.
  • Participants must bring all necessities for survival, including water, food & shelter.
  • There is no commercial vending at this event.
  • Commercial use of moving or still images taken at Burning Man is forbidden without permission of Burning Man.
  • We ask that you tread lightly on the desert and Leave No Trace when you depart.
